Vintage 8mm home movie footage from Cairo, Egypt, in 1946, showing a vibrant scene along a riverbank. Lush purple bougainvillea bushes bloom in the foreground, framing traditional sailboats moored along the water. In the distance, an old fort with crenellated walls and a domed structure stands under a bright, sunny sky. The film exhibits classic Super 8 grain, color shifts, and natural camera movement, capturing a nostalgic moment of daily life and transportation along the Nile. The shot is framed by dark tree branches, adding a natural vignette effect.
